Here they state https://www.toonboom.com/support/policies :
You have up to 90 days to renew your support contract after it has lapsed. Once renewed, the support period will be backdated. Please be aware that you cannot renew support if a new release of software has been announced after your support contract has lapsed unless you first upgrade to the new version.
